LITTLE KNOWN FACTS ABOUT LOCAL SEO SPECIALIST.

Little Known Facts About Local SEO Specialist.

Local Web optimization is an essential strategy for numerous companies aiming to focus on shoppers in distinct geographic spots. about our 10+ calendar year history, our Website positioning specialists have served 1000s of present & earlier clients throughout many areas. The LAD team led the way in which in assisting our full spectrum of shoppers

read more